Summary

Building 94 was designed by Alan Powell in association with Pels Innes Nielson Kosloff to house the TAFE School of Design (RMIT University, undated). The building was completed in 1996 and won a Royal Australian Institute of Architects' (RAIA) Merit Award in the same year (RMIT University, undated; Architecture Media, 1 September 1996).
